Overview of Tsurumi Ryokuchi Koopo (鶴見緑地コーポ)
Tsurumi Ryokuchi Koopo (鶴見緑地コーポ) is a 45-year-old condominium located at Oosakashi Tsurumiku Yokozutsumi 5 Choume 5-36 (大阪市鶴見区横堤5丁目5-36), Osaka, Japan. Built in 1981, it comprises 268 units in a Steel Reinforced Concrete (SRC) structure. It was constructed by Oobayashi Kumi (大林組).

Investment Perspective
Building depreciation: In Japan, buildings depreciate significantly over time. Wood-frame houses depreciate to near-zero value at around 22 years, while RC structures depreciate more slowly but still lose value. At 45 years old, much of the building's value has already depreciated — the price largely reflects land value and location premium.
Scale advantage: With 268 units, this is a relatively large condominium. Larger buildings typically benefit from lower per-unit maintenance and repair reserve costs.
Key cultural note: Unlike the US where properties typically appreciate over time, Japanese buildings depreciate while the underlying land tends to hold or gain value. This means buyers should evaluate the land-to-building value ratio carefully.
